Transaction 21294236cc8fa568a022644f0fb6dfcc86071942a9d533bdd3caa2c65571c973

1 Input
2 Outputs
  • 21294236cc8fa568a022644f0fb6dfcc86071942a9d533bdd3caa2c65571c973:0
  • value  51112
    address  1KYxZ9merrtPFJR8hEzmPCPhPb7qoDSerq
  • 21294236cc8fa568a022644f0fb6dfcc86071942a9d533bdd3caa2c65571c973:1
  • value  11182762
    address  13ErzSYXP68AJNnwuYmnXjsFhgUnKcfYwW